Overview
Are you a commercially driven pricing specialist with strong FM knowledge and advanced analytical skills? Arcus FM is seeking a FM Pricing & Estimating Manager to play a pivotal role in shaping our pricing strategy, driving competitive tenders, and supporting business growth.
You’ll develop and manage pricing models that directly support Arcus FM’s new business opportunities, contract renewals, and growth ambitions. Working closely with Operations, Procurement, and Business Development, you’ll deliver competitive, accurate, and insight-led pricing that balances risk, value, and profitability.
This role is key to ensuring seamless mobilisation from bid stage through to operational delivery, while continuously improving our approach to pricing and insights.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op, maintain, and manage central pricing models aligned to business strategy.
- Lead the bid pricing process for tenders ranging from £500k to £40m+.
- Complete labour loading and interpret asset data to produce accurate FM pricing.
- Analyse tender documentation to identify risks, margins, and commercial implications.
- Build and communicate pricing models and commercial risks to stakeholders, including C-Suite.
- Partner with Procurement to obtain supply chain quotations and ensure best value.
- Collaborate with Operations and Mobilisation teams to ensure smooth handover of pricing to delivery.
- Analyse post-go-live contract performance to identify insights and improve future tenders.
- Create and develop database solutions to strengthen standard pricing metrics.
- Undertake strategic projects to support wider business improvement.
